How much does it cost to rent a home in Port St. Lucie?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Port St. Lucie 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,552 | $1,200 | $8,500 |
Port St. Lucie 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,977 | $1,800 | $10,000+ |
Port St. Lucie 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,268 | $2,215 | $10,000+ |
Port St. Lucie 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,778 | $2,900 | $6,500 |
Port St. Lucie 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,747 | $3,500 | $3,995 |
Port St. Lucie 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,000 | $8,000 | $8,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Port St. Lucie
What type of rentals are currently available in Port St. Lucie?
There are currently 103 Apartments for Rent in Port St. Lucie, FL with pricing that ranges from $869 to $8,706. There are also 848 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Port St. Lucie ranging from $850 to $15,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Port St. Lucie?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Port St. Lucie ranges from $850 to $15,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,485.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Port St. Lucie?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Port St. Lucie range from $1,128 to $3,073,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,800 to $11,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,215 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,244.
